 After attacking the Congress Party and its vice-president Rahul Gandhi, Vijay Mallya's Twitter account was hacked on Friday morning by a group that identified itself as the 'Legion'. 

Mallya's Twitter and e-mail accounts were reportedly hacked and some of his personal and financial details, including passwords, addresses and phone number, were posted online.

The hackers have threatened to expose more financial details of Mallya in coming days.

Gandhi's Twitter account @OfficeOfRG (Office of RG) was hacked on November 30. The Twitter handle logs show both Gandhi and Congress' account were operated from Sweden, Romania, US, Canada and Thailand.

 

Mallya, whose defunct Kingfisher Airlines owes more than Rs 9,000 crore to various banks, had left India on March 2.

On December 2, a special anti-money laundering court confirmed an attachment of assets order worth Rs 1,411 crore issued by the Enforcement Directorate (ED) against United Breweries Holdings Ltd (UBHL) and others in connection with its money laundering probe against the liquor baron and others. This is one of the largest attachment of assets made by ED in a PMLA case till now.

The agency had registered a money laundering case against him and others based on an FIR registered last year by the CBI.
